What Causes Mononucleosis With A History Of Grave S Disease?
I was diagnosed with Graves Disease when I was 35...the doctors did the radioactive uptake to kill my thyroid because it wasn t treatable with medications..at the age of 42 I contracted mononucleosis from my son... I am now 46 and once again have mono...is there any correlation between the Graves disease & the mono...I ve also been diagnosed with have a staph infection and polyps in my sinuses
I think there is no connection between Grave's disease and mononucleosis. Grave is an autoimmune disease that immune system fights thyroid cells especially and mononucleosis is a viral infection caused by Ebstein Bar virus. Mononucleosis is not even related to staphylococcus infection and nasal polyps.
